What Makes a Gas Water Heater Energy Efficient?
Energy efficiency in gas water heaters is primarily determined by the unit’s energy factor (EF) rating The EF rating measures how efficiently the water heater converts its energy source into hot water The higher the EF rating, the more energy-efficient the unit is Additionally, features such as insulation, burner design, and thermal efficiency can also contribute to the overall energy efficiency of a gas water heater.
In addition to the EF rating, other factors that can affect the energy efficiency of a gas water heater include size, fuel type, and maintenance It’s important to choose a water heater that is the right size for your household’s hot water needs to avoid excess energy consumption Furthermore, regular maintenance, such as flushing the tank and checking for leaks, can help to ensure that your water heater is operating at peak efficiency.
